- Batik Patterns: Batik is a traditional Indonesian art form that involves using wax to resist dye on fabric. In tattoos, these intricate patterns are often adapted to create stunning designs. They can be used to symbolize a variety of things, from prosperity and good fortune to protection and spirituality. You can get a full batik sleeve, or incorporate individual motifs into a smaller design. The versatility of batik patterns makes them a favorite among tattoo enthusiasts. - Wayang Kulit Figures: Wayang kulit is a traditional Javanese shadow puppet theater. The puppets are often depicted in tattoos, representing characters from epic stories like the Ramayana and Mahabharata. These tattoos can be incredibly detailed and visually striking, and they often carry deep symbolic meanings. The characters themselves represent virtues, vices, and archetypes. These designs can range from simple outlines to highly detailed renderings. These tattoos are not only visually captivating but also serve as a reminder of the rich storytelling traditions of Indonesia. It's a way to carry a piece of Indonesian theater with you. - Mythical Creatures: Indonesian mythology is full of fascinating creatures, from dragons and garudas (a mythical bird-like creature) to various spirits and deities. These creatures are often incorporated into tattoos, adding a mystical and powerful element to the designs. These tattoos can be vibrant, colorful, and highly stylized. Mythical creatures symbolize various qualities, like strength, courage, and wisdom. For those who want to express their connection to the spiritual realm, these tattoos are a perfect choice. - Traditional Motifs: Beyond specific figures, many artists incorporate traditional Indonesian motifs into their tattoos. This could include geometric patterns, floral designs, or symbols representing nature, prosperity, or protection. These motifs add a layer of depth and meaning to the tattoo. You might see a lotus flower representing purity, or a geometric pattern symbolizing harmony and balance. The options are endless, as Indonesian art is filled with vibrant and significant elements. - Aftercare is Key: Once you get your tattoo, follow the artist's aftercare instructions carefully. This will help your tattoo heal properly and prevent infection. Keep the area clean, moisturized, and protected from the sun. Proper aftercare will help to preserve your tattoo's color and clarity for years to come.
